In open-angle glaucoma, the iridocorneal angle remains open, but the trabecular meshwork becomes stiff, slowing down the outflow of aqueous humor. This causes a buildup of aqueous humor in the anterior chamber, leading to a sudden increase in intraocular pressure. The treatment for open-angle glaucoma focuses on reducing the elevated intraocular pressure by either decreasing the secretion of aqueous humor or increasing its outflow.

Area of Science:

  • Ophthalmology
  • Vision Science
  • Aging Research

Background:

  • Presbyopia is the age-related loss of the eye's ability to focus on near objects.
  • It is caused by the increasing stiffness and thickness of the eye's lens.
  • This reduces the lens's capacity to change shape and refractive power.

Purpose of the Study:

  • To provide an updated overview of current presbyopia correction options.
  • To discuss the limitations associated with existing treatments.

Main Methods:

  • Literature review of current presbyopia management strategies.
  • Analysis of the efficacy and drawbacks of various corrective options.

Main Results:

  • Reading glasses remain the most common remedy for presbyopia.
  • Alternative treatments include monovision with monofocal lenses, multifocal contact lenses, intraocular lenses, corneal implants, and refractive surgery.
  • Each method presents unique advantages and disadvantages.

Conclusions:

  • A range of options exists for managing presbyopia, from simple aids to surgical interventions.
  • Understanding the limitations of each treatment is crucial for effective patient management.
